			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p><a href="http://www.sellitanywhere.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/07/google-accounts.gif"><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-635" title="google-accounts" src="http://www.sellitanywhere.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/07/google-accounts-150x150.gif"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a>Everyone is familiar with Google as a search engine and free email client, but you may not be aware of the many free web tools available through Google. Tech savvy web masters rely on tools like Google Analytics to maximize their online audience. Here is a quick look at our favorite Google aps you should be using.</p>
<p><a href="http://adwords.google.com" target="_blank">Google AdWords</a> is Google&#8217;s pay-per-click advertising program that allows web site owners to place ads based on keywords to drive traffic to their sites. Customers who are searching for your product or service are displayed ads on Google and their content network. Site owners pay a fee when a when people click on your ad. This type of advertising can be extremely effective when paired with the right mix of keywords, product and cost can be achieved.<span id="more-632"></span></p>
<p><a href="http://www.google.com/services/adsense_tour/index.html" target="_blank">AdSense</a> is Google&#8217;s advertising program that allows web owners to make money through their website with Google administered ads. Web admins are paid on a pay-per-click basis. Ads can be personalized to fit the look and feel of your site and Google provides real-time reports that lets you know how your ads are doing and how much you are making.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.youtube.com/" target="_blank">YouTube</a> having your own YouTube channel is the best way to catalog and store video&#8217;s online. Why hog your hard drive when you have free and virtually unlimited acces to YouTube. Most sites will benefit from having some types of video on their site to lure in traffic. Every day millions of people search YouTube for video how-to&#8217;s. If you are selling a product, use a video to show how to use it. If you are marketing a service, show examples of how you have helped other customers. The possibilities are endless!</p>
<p><a href="http://www.google.com/google-d-s/tour1.html" target="_blank">Google Docs</a> is Google&#8217;s online office suite. Use it to create and share text documents, spreadsheets, presentations, and more. Docs is especially useful to organizations that need to have many people work on and review a project across different operating systems.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.google.com/support/webmasters/?hl=en" target="_blank">Google Web Master Tools</a><strong> </strong>gives you the tools to control how Google sees your site. Add, delete, and update URL&#8217;s so old and inaccurate information is not being indexed, let Google know when you have added content and how to index it.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.google.com/analytics/" target="_blank">Google Analytics</a> Arguably the single most important tool in your web developer&#8217;s box is Google Analytics. This is how you find out who is viewing your site, where the traffic is coming from, how individual pages are performing and more. In fact the many reports available are too numerous to name here. If you only use one Google product-this is the one.</p>

<p>Geo Targeting</h2>
<div style="margin: 0;">
<ul>
<li>Use one country per campaign</li>
<li>One account per country. (Yahoo?)</li>
<li>Radius targeting: Marketing for a radius around a specific location. Microsoft refers to this as “Order Level”</li>
<li>Yahoo Panama – Yahoo’s New marketing platform (1st quarter 2007)</li>
<li>Ad preview tool shows what people will see for targeted sites outside of your geographic area. IE.. In Texas working with a California customer.</li>
<li>Geo Keywords: State, State abbreviation, cities, neighborhood, Zip, Area code, counties, airport code, regional lingo such as Panhandle or the Loop.</li>
<li>Different countries respond to different offers. All English not created equal!</li>
<li>Negative Keywords – “Higher quality score”</li>
<li>Advanced Yahoo “Phrase and Broad”</li>
<li>Singulars and plurals on Google &amp; Microsoft, Yahoo uses a match driver</li>
<li><a title="SEMPO" href="http://www.sempo.org/home" target="_blank">Search Engine Marketing Professional Organization</a></li>
<li>Key words, ad, and landing pages must be carefully coordinated”</li>
<li>Dynamic Keywords – Content added to page based on keywords specified by the searcher. Used to distinguish searcher intent.</li>
</ul>
<h2 style="margin: 0;">Match Types</h2>
<div style="margin: 0;">
<ul>
<li>Broad match</li>
<li>Phrase “Quotes”</li>
<li>Exact [Brackets]</li>
</ul>
</div>
</div>
<div style="margin: 0;"><a href="http://www.sempo.org/home"></a></div>
<h2>Mona Elesseily</h2>
<div style="margin: 0;">
<ul>
<li>Editorial Review – If you have problems contact customer service.</li>
<li>Google and MSN automatic review while Yahoo is a manual process.</li>
<li>It is necessary to be familiar with the editorial policies of each search engine.</li>
<li>Trademarked terms are considered in quality score.</li>
<li>You may need to apply for an exemption to use a trademarked term such as “Enterprise”</li>
<li>Find good people at each search engine to deal with.</li>
</ul>
</div>
<h2>Brad Byrd – New Gate Internet</h2>
<div style="margin: 0;">
<ul>
<li>Evaluate ads yourself! Don’t count on search engine statistics. Count conversions not clicks. Yahoo will be offering a conversion tracking option with “Panama”.</li>
<li>Conversions need not necessarily based on sales. In some cases other valuable customer may be considered a conversion.</li>
<li>Tracking Cookies can track repeat users of the site. In some cases this could be considered a conversion.</li>
</ul>
